Transaction 56246cbfe361d41078531e57ec42b86ee7885728cf04273f19f04dd3a673f75c
1 Input
2 Outputs
- 56246cbfe361d41078531e57ec42b86ee7885728cf04273f19f04dd3a673f75c:0
- 56246cbfe361d41078531e57ec42b86ee7885728cf04273f19f04dd3a673f75c:1
value 2713856
address 3P21G786YHehNakoMUwxqgsX9sV64zJZHQ
value 1725958685
address 1EXEWWHxakJsbBZtj53eU2K3a38afDbgoD